In August 2010 Els Dietvorst moved from an urban context, Brussels, to Wexford, a rural hamlet in southern Ireland. As shepherdess she is closer to nature and is facing "death" as an active and overwhelming strength.
The exhibition One Was Killed for Beauty, the Other One Was Shot, the 2 Others Died Naturally with three installations brings in a fairytale way these issues into focus and draws the viewer into a universe of beauty, destruction and death.
